MSc in Chemical Engineering at USask Overview
MSc in Chemical Engineering at University of Saskatchewan is a popular program among Indian students. For admission to this course, which has 2 years, an Indian student needs to be eligible and submit documents. The documents to be submitted are academic qualifications, standardised text and language test score, resume and others. English language tests accepted by the university such as IELTS, TOEFL, PTE and Duolingo. The first-year tuition fee for this course at the time of admission is CAD 11,097. Also, there is regular spending on food, travel, staying, books, supplies and others. The annual cost of living is typically CAD 13,020 at University of Saskatchewan.

MSc in Chemical Engineering at USask Fees
The fee breakup of the University of Saskatchewan MSc in Chemical Engineering includes the first-year tuition fee and cost of living. The cost of living will include expenses like rent for accommodation, meals, and other utilities. The total average University of Saskatchewan cost of living can be around CAD 13,020. The first-year tuition fees MSc in Chemical Engineering is CAD 11,097. Students must note that the total expenses are subject to vary, depending on the additional charges set by the University of Saskatchewan. MSc in Chemical Engineering at USask Highlights
- This research based program will allow students to conduct original research with access to state of the art facilities, research centres, and labs
- Students can choose any of the five research areas: Corrosion
- Fluid Mechanics- includes Multiphase pipeline flow, rheology and fluidization
- Reaction Engineering- includes studies in conversion of biomass and other waste materials to synthesis gas and value-added bioproducts, biodiesel production and utilization, alkylation and isomerization to value-added bio-products, hydrotreating of heavy gas oil, conversion of mercaptans and hydrogen sulphide on carbon catalysts, production and utilization of activated carbon and production and applications of carbon nano-tubes,
- the development of renewable source of energy and chemicals from biomass-derived oils under catalytic reaction conditions
